write 28 + 24 as a product of two factors using the greatest common factor and the distributive property

Answer:

4 * 13

Explanation:

Okay, so we have to use the distributive property to solve this. We know 28 and 24 have a common factor of 4. If we factor a 4 out of 28 + 24, then we get 4 * (7 + 6). Adding 7 + 6, we get 13. Therefore, we get 4 * 13.
